Ticket: Staging env misconfigured for Siftgate bloom filter

The bloom layer in front of the Pellet KV store is rejecting all lookups in staging because the env file was copied from the dev template without credentials. False-positive tuning values are fine; only the auth line is missing. To unblock the weekly demo, the Pellet admission secret must be set on the following line.

env line for yaguf-fajop: LEDGER_TOKEN13=fb08984397349

Subject: Handover — Tidemark widget release duties

Taking over from me effective Monday. Current state: v2.8 is tagged, staged on the Corvel ring, not yet promoted. Security items outstanding: the tide-prediction fetcher still allows HTTP fallback on one legacy endpoint — blocked from promotion until that's removed. Widget bundles are signed at build; verification is enforced at the CDN edge. Rotation cadence is 60 days; last rotation was three weeks ago. For continuity, the active release signing key is included below.

deploy key for kajof-fajop: bky6_gDHw9Q

## Changelog — FareForge Rules Engine v4.2

Defaults have changed for plugin authors. Dimensional weight rounding now uses banker's rounding instead of ceiling, and zone-fallback is disabled unless explicitly enabled. Plugins relying on the old ceiling behavior must set the rounding mode themselves. Rate-cache TTL was shortened to reduce stale surcharge bugs. The full set of new default configuration values ships as follows.

service settings:
pelath:
  pin: 5871
  tenant: belox
  seal: seal_d5a7bfb2
  metrics_host: metrics.pelath.qorvelcorp.test
  standby_team: oliys
  escalation: kelath-nordor
  nonce: 338058

**Alert: EXIF scrub failure rate elevated — PixelGate uploader**

The PixelGate ingestion service strips EXIF metadata (GPS, device info) from all user-uploaded images before storage. This alert fires when the scrub step fails for more than 2% of uploads in a 10-minute window. Failed images are quarantined, not published. Recent changes to the image-decoding library are the most likely cause; please review the latest merge to the scrubber module. If the regression is confirmed, notify the privacy pipeline team.

escalation mailbox, bafog-fafog: ulador@paliqlabs.internal